Facundo: Would you prepare a schedule which shows how much deferred tax was accrued in August and September 2001 relating to the TNPC (The New Power Company) warrants. This deferred tax would have been accrued in Harrier I LLC, Grizzly I LLC, Pronghorn I LLC and Roadrunner I LLC. Let's discuss before you get started. Thanks, John.

Please let me know your availability for a meeting on Friday morning from 8:00 until 10:00. We are scheduled in EB1701.

The purpose of the meeting is to discuss the various entities that have recorded taxes related to the TNPC stock and warrants. As identitfed below, please bring an analysis of the activity - life to date - of the taxes recorded, by entity, by period, by event. We will develop an analysis of the steps that will be necessary as the various transactions related to the stock and warrants are unwound.

John Swafford/Danny Wilson - Raptor activity through September business prior to any write-offs booked at quarter end

Bill Bowes/Shanna Husser - FAS 125 transactions recorded related to the warrants

Shanna Husser/Patty Lee - stock and warrant transactions related to initial placement and EES activity, including the original SAB 51 gain, the tax gain on the warrants, and the equity losses recorded to date

We also want to determine the impact of the write-off anticipated for the third quarter and what the deferred tax requirements will be after the Raptor structure is unwound.
